Specifications
Series: --
Packaging: Tape & Reel (TR) 
Part Status: Active
Voltage - Zener (Nom) (Vz): 51V
Tolerance: ±5%
Power - Max: 2W
Impedance (Max) (Zzt): 48 Ohms
Current - Reverse Leakage @ Vr: 500nA @ 38.8V
Voltage - Forward (Vf) (Max) @ If: 1.2V @ 200mA
Operating Temperature: -65°C ~ 150°C
Mounting Type: Through Hole
Package / Case: DO-204AL, DO-41, Axial
Supplier Device Package: DO-204AL (DO-41)
Base Part Number: 2EZ51

Diodes - Zener - Single

The 2EZ51D5/TR12 is a single zener diode, an electronic component that can be used to control the voltage in an electric circuit. Zener diodes are often used to regulate the voltage in a power supply, as part of an overvoltage protection circuit, or as clamping devices. This component is a good choice for applications that require a low voltage drop and are not exposed to a high thermal load.

Operation

Essentially, a zener diode is a standard semiconductor diode but with a modified reverse-biased voltage breakdown behavior. When the voltage across the diode reaches its reverse breakdown voltage, the diode enters a region of high current conduction, known as the avalanche region. The reverse current through the diode is limited only by the external circuit impedance. This current is referred to as the zener current.
